Algebraic Extensions for Symbolic Summation
The main result of this thesis is an effective method to extend Karr’s symbolic summation framework to algebraic extensions. These arise, for example, when working with expressions involving (−1)n. An implementation of this method, including a modernised version of Karr’s algorithm is also presented. Karr’s algorithm is the summation analogue of the Risch algorithm for indefinite integration. متن کاملA difference ring theory for symbolic summation☆
A summation framework is developed that enhances Karr's difference field approach. It covers not only indefinite nested sums and products in terms of transcendental extensions, but it can treat, e.g., nested products defined over roots of unity. متن کاملSymbolic Summation | Some Recent Developments
In recent years, the problem of symbolic summation has received much attention due to the exciting applications of Zeilberger’s method for definite hypergeometric summation. This lead to renewed interest in the central part of the algorithmic machinery, Gosper’s “classical” method for indefinite hypergeometric summation.
